Hawaii Photographer Again – Same Old New Chapter

Good Bye Fiji, Aloha Hawaii!
Just four short months ago I said good bye to Hawaii to pursue photography in Europe.

Instead I spent some unproductive time in Europe, ended up in Fiji and now have returned to Hawaii.
I spent one month in Fiji instead of the planned three, due to the circumstances and the lack of possibilities I decided to return at this time.

This last 4 months is what I would call flexible planning :) !
The trip as every trip thought me a great deal about myself and put some things in better perspective.

I have written about the state of Hawaii photography, Hawaii photographers and Hawaiian models and I am not expecting to take Hawaii by storm this time around either.
Instead I will attempt to use imagination, intuition, inspiration, curiosity to name a few to continue my photography journey and possibly embrace different styles.

The desire to try new avenues comes from frustration with flaky models, and from the fact that I have been doing photography which has not been satisfying.

What could be the reasons why I have been on a photography path which might not have been the right one?
Perhaps the question is wrong and there isn’t a right or wrong way to do photography. As Neo said: “Choice. The problem is choice”.
I could list outside factors like flaky models, strong competition, lack of opportunities but those sound a lot like complaining and placing the responsibility on easy targets and not myself.

Some upcoming goals (or choices):
- photographing only what I really love, curious about or intrigued by
- photographing more and with more freedom not being bound by the pursuit of perfection
- gaining more knowledge of the business aspect of photography

I have been away from Hawaii 3 times so this is my 4th return.
Each time a very different experience. Let’s see what happens next!
